A leading innovation consultancy in the UK seeks a Knowledge Transfer Manager to lead projects aimed at decarbonising industries. This senior role involves collaborating with stakeholders across the renewable energy sector, ensuring innovative technologies are developed and deployed effectively.
The successful candidate will have a strong technical background in low carbon energy, experience in stakeholder engagement, and a network of contacts in the industry. This full-time position offers a competitive salary and opportunities for professional development.
